Contact Us

Contact Us

Phone: +44 (0)7885 464 100
Email: hello@owlbusinessconsultancy.com

Owl Business Consultancy
4th Floor – Silverstream House
45 Fitzroy Street – Fitzrovia
London W1T 6EB

Your privacy is taken seriously. Please see our Privacy Policy which details how your personal data is handled.

Name